Job Summary: The Department of Surgery, in collaboration with the Huntsman Cancer Hospital Oncology surgeons’ group, located primarily at the Huntsman Cancer Hospital, is seeking advanced practice clinicians to join the team. These APCs will function as nighttime hospitalists providing inpatient care for the Department of Surgery’s admitted cancer patients. The APC will have responsibilities for preliminary nighttime patient assessments, triage of questions and care requests from nursing, communication with the primary team, initial review of new surgical consults… in collaboration with the admitting attending surgeon.

Responsibilities

  • Evening/night coverage of urgent patient care issues of the Department of Surgery patients admitted to the Huntsman Cancer Hospital.
  • Assistance with inpatient nursing needs and nighttime inpatient consultations.
  • Assist in operating room as needed, for evening emergent return to OR cases
  • Shared responsibility for teaching residents, medical students and APC students
  • Possible active participation in developing and implementing research or quality improvement measures
  • Participation in team sign-out with the primary team resident each evening.
